ANALYSIS OF ALTERNATIVES AND SELECTED ALTERNATIVE <br />The purpose of this project is bringing the Milton Dam spillway up to current State standards to ensure <br />the continued safe operations of the dam. Three aiternatives were considered for this project: <br />1) Do nothing <br />2) Enlarge the existing spillway using a concrete control structure and earthen channels <br />upstream and downstream from the spillway crest <br />3) Enlarge the existing spillway using a concrete control structure and concrete channels <br />upstream and downstream from the spillway crest <br />Analvsis of Alternatives <br />A/teinative No. ~- Do Nothinq <br />One course of action considered was the Do Nothing Alternative. This alternative suggests performing <br />no repair work on either the outlet gates or the outlet conduits. No construction costs will be involved. <br />Given this alternative FRICO would continue to operate using the existing facilities. <br />By not increasing the capacity of the spillway, FRICO would be ignoring the requirements of the SEO and <br />Milton Dam would not provide the State's required level of protection against the design storm. Without <br />these improvements the SEO would likely take one of the following actions: issue a fill restriction or <br />require that FRICO empty the reservoir, <br />A fill restriction would limit the amount of water that FRICO can store in the reservoir resulting in less <br />water to shareholders. This would impact the crops that could be grown by irrigators and the amount of <br />water that can be used by municipal water users. A SEO directive to drain the reservoir would result in no <br />water to shareholders. Either condition would result in significant financial impact to shareholders. <br />Failure to modify the spillway could also threaten the safety of the dam.
